[人足中跟骨距骨前、中关节面及其相关韧带的异质性]

[Heterogeneity of the anterior and middle talar articular faces of calcaneus and their associated ligaments in the human foot].

作者信息

Murata K, Sakai T

机构信息

Department of Anatomy, School of Medicine, Juntendo University, Tokyo, Japan.

出版信息

Kaibogaku Zasshi. 1994 Feb;69(1):42-9.

PMID:8178618
Abstract

The human talocalcaneonavicular joint was dissected and structural heterogeneity of their articular faces and associated ligaments were observed. The facies articulatio talaris anterior and media were either separated from each other (separate type), bordered by narrowing (constricted type) or continuous without any border (continuous type). In the separate type, the superficial layer of plantar calcaneonavicular ligament entered the grave between the anterior and middle articular faces. In the constricted type, the superficial layer of plantar calcaneonavicular ligament entered the neck of two articular faces from the medial side, and a part of the calcaneonavicular interosseous talocalcaneo ligament entered the neck from the lateral side. In the continuous type, the deep layer of calcaneonavicular ligament attached to the base of these articular faces. Furthermore, we observed mobility of the talotarsal joint, and found tendencies that feet of the separate type showed the smallest mobility and those of continuous type the largest mobility. It was concluded that the structure of the articular faces of the talocalcaneonavicular joint were variable and were correlated not only with the structure of their associated ligaments, but also with their mobility.

摘要

对人距跟舟关节进行解剖,并观察其关节面和相关韧带的结构异质性。距骨前关节面和中关节面要么相互分离(分离型),要么以变窄为界(缩窄型),要么连续无边界(连续型)。在分离型中,跟舟足底韧带浅层进入前后关节面之间的沟内。在缩窄型中,跟舟足底韧带浅层从内侧进入两个关节面的颈部,距跟舟骨间韧带的一部分从外侧进入颈部。在连续型中,跟舟韧带深层附着于这些关节面的底部。此外,我们观察了跗骨间关节的活动度,发现分离型足的活动度最小,连续型足的活动度最大。得出结论,距跟舟关节关节面的结构是可变的,不仅与其相关韧带的结构有关,还与其活动度有关。
